Description
These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ders are coated in a flavorful honey mustard glaze and crunchy panko breadcrumbs, then oven-baked until perfectly golden. Kid-approved, weeknight-friendly, and perfect for dipping!
Ingredients
8–10 chicken tenders
1/3 cup Dijon mustard
1/3 cup honey
1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
1 teaspoon garlic powder
Salt and pepper, to taste
Cooking spray (for baking)
Dipping sauces: honey mustard, ranch, or ketchup
Instructions
1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
2. In a small bowl, combine the Dijon mustard, honey, and garlic powder. Mix well and set aside.
3. Add panko breadcrumbs to a shallow dish or plate.
4. Season chicken tenders liberally with salt and pepper.
5. Dip each tender in the honey mustard mixture, allowing excess to drip off.
6. Then dredge each tender in the panko breadcrumbs, coating evenly.
7. Arrange the coated tenders on a greased or parchment-lined baking sheet.
8. Lightly spray the tops with cooking spray for an extra crispy finish.
9. Bake for 18–20 minutes, or until golden brown and the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
10. Serve immediately with honey mustard, ranch, or ketchup.
Notes
For extra crispiness, flip the tenders halfway through baking.
These reheat well in an air fryer or oven.
You can make them gluten-free by using gluten-free panko.
